Efecto del aceite de copaiba (Copaifera Officinalis) en la cicatrización de heridas cutáneas provocadas en ratones de laboratorio

Abstract

Objetivo. Determinar la efectividad del Copaifera officinalis en la cicatrización de heridas cutáneas provocadas en ratones de laboratorio. Métodos. Se diseñó un estudio experimental, con 60 ratones de laboratorio de la Facultad de Medicina Veterinaria y Zootecnia de la Universidad Nacional Hermilio Valdizán de Huánuco, durante el período de noviembre 2014 a marzo del 2015. Se dividió a los animales en 3 grupos de 20 ratones cada uno, dos controles y un experimental. Los datos se obtuvieron mediante una guía de observación. Se utilizaron las Pruebas de t Student, ANOVA y Tukey. Resultados. La media del tiempo de cicatrización de las heridas cutáneas de los ratones de laboratorio, del grupo experimental fue de 13,3 días; del grupo control 1 de 16,2 días y del grupo control 2 de 15,8 días con tratamiento de cada 12 horas. Asimismo, se encontró diferencias significativas entre grupo experimental y el grupo control 1 (P≤0,000) y grupo control 2 (P≤0,000) con tratamiento de cada 12 horas en el tiempo de cicatrización de las heridas. Conclusiones. Los resultados sugieren que el aceite de copaiba extraído en el laboratorio es eficiente y seguro debido a que se redujo el tiempo de cicatrización de la herida sobre todo con tratamiento de cada 12 horas.
